[5/7] Preview: Paula Maya CD release at One-2-One

May 4, 2015 By Austin Vida Staff

New-CD-2015-CoverIluminarFinalThursday, May 7, Austin-based keyboardist and singer/songwriter Paula Maya will be celebrating the release of her sixth studio album, Iluminar, with a release show at One-2-One Bar. For the release show, Maya will be joined by Antonio Dionisio. The show will also serve as a sort of a tour kickoff for a Brazilian tour in late Maya will embark on before returning back to the U.S. to tour stateside.

Officially released May 4, Iluminar is heavily influenced by her Brazilian roots, just as much as her home base of Austin. According to the official press release, the new album is Maya’s first album sung predominately in Portuguese (90%) and focused on Brazilian music, jazz and world inspired rhythms such as African soukous and Latin beats. It is a sharp contrast to her previous releases which featured a mix of pop, rock, classical and electronica.

Iluminar, which means “to shine” in Portuguese, features eight songs; seven originals and one traditional bossa nova. It was recorded at her record label studio – Yellow House Records – based in South Austin with Lefty and Robert Wyatt, mastered by Nick Landis at Terra Nova, and manufactured by Matt Eskey’s Any and All Media.
